Heat pump replacement services involve removing an outdated or malfunctioning heat pump system and installing a new unit to ensure continued efficient heating and cooling. Technicians typically evaluate the existing system to determine compatibility with the property’s needs, then carefully remove the old equipment before installing the new heat pump. This process may include upgrading certain components, such as thermostats or ductwork, to optimize performance and ensure the new system functions properly within the property’s infrastructure.

Replacement Costs - The typical cost for heat pump replacement services ranges from $3,500 to $7,000, depending on the system size and complexity. Larger or high-efficiency units may cost more, with some installations reaching up to $9,000. Variations depend on local labor rates and equipment choices.
Equipment Prices - The price of the heat pump unit itself generally falls between $1,500 and $4,000. Premium models with advanced features can cost upwards of $5,000, impacting the overall replacement expense.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ific system requirements.
Installation Expenses - Installation costs typically range from $2,000 to $4,000, influenced by factors such as existing ductwork, electrical upgrades, and system complexity. Additional work, like duct modifications, can increase the total price. Local service providers can assess site-specific needs for accurate quotes.
Additional Charges - Additional costs may include permits, disposal of old equipment, or system upgrades, often adding $500 to $1,500. These expenses vary based on local regulations and the scope of work. Contact local contractors for detailed cost assessments tailored to individual projects.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my heat pump needs to be replaced? Signs such as frequent breakdowns, decreased efficiency, or uneven heating may indicate the need for a replacement. Consulting with local heating professionals can help determine the best course of action.
What factors influence the cost of a heat pump replacement? Costs can vary based on the size of the unit, installation complexity, and local labor rates. Contacting local service providers can provide more specific information tailored to your property.
How long does a heat pump replacement typically take? The installation process usually spans a day or two, depending on the system's complexity and site conditions. Local contractors can give an estimated timeframe during the consultation.
Are there different types of heat pumps available for replacement? Yes, options include air-source, ground-source, and ductless models, among others. Local pros can help identify the most suitable type for your needs.
